What are the benefits of HDI PCBs?
-Exceptional versatility: HDI boards are perfect for applications where minimizing weight, conserving space, and ensuring reliability and performance are key priorities.
-Compact structure: By utilizing blind vias, buried vias, and microvias, the overall space required for the board is significantly reduced.
-Enhanced signal integrity: HDI employs via-in-pad and blind via technologies, enabling closer placement of components and reducing signal path lengths. This technology eliminates via stubs, minimizes signal reflection, and improves signal quality, ensuring superior transmission stability due to shorter paths.
-Superior reliability: The use of stacked vias provides robust protection against harsh environmental conditions.
-Cost-efficiency: A 6-layer HDI board can deliver the same functionality as a traditional 8-layer through-hole PCB, without compromising quality.
What are the applications of HDI PCBs?
Healthcare
HDI PCBs play a big role in medical industry. Medical devices often use HDI technology due to its ability to fit into compact devices like implants, lab equipment, and imaging systems. These devices play a vital role in disease diagnosis and life support, such as pacemakers and diagnostic tools. With miniaturized cameras, HDI makes it possible to observe internal conditions and deliver accurate diagnoses. The shrinking size of these cameras doesn't compromise image quality, thanks to HDI technology. Procedures like colonoscopies are becoming less invasive and more comfortable as the devices shrink in size and improve in clarity.
Military and Aerospace
HDI is used in military communications and strategic systems, such as missiles and defense technologies. Its durability and resilience in harsh environments make it ideal for both aerospace and military applications.
Smartphones and Tablets
HDI PCBs are the backbone of modern smartphones, tablets, and other portable electronics, enabling thinner, more compact designs with enhanced functionality.
Automotive
Automakers are drawn to small-sized HDI PCBs, which help maximize space in vehicles. With the rise of advanced cars from companies like Tesla, integrating electronic systems to enhance driving experiences is now a priority.
Wearable Technology
With the popularity of devices like the Apple Watch and VR headsets, HDI technology has become a key player in the wearable tech market, especially among younger consumers due to its excellent performance and practicality.
